Report: Monta Ellis to opt out of deal « Hang Time Blog | NBA.com
By Jonathan Hartzell, for NBA.com
Monta Ellis will opt out of the final year of his contract with the Milwaukee Bucks, according to reports. Ellis was set to make $11 million next season with the Bucks, who reportedly offered him a 3-year, $36 million extension earlier in the season.
It seems unlikely that the streaky, 27-year-old guard will garner a higher salary on the open market than the one hes turning down, but his unwillingness to stay in Milwaukee and his reported interest in teaming up with Dwight Howard undoubtedly fueled this decision. Ellis is one of the most explosive scorers in the league. However, hes coming off the worst shooting season of his career at only 41.6 percent from the field on 17.5 attempts per game. An offense simply cannot be successful with its main scorer shooting so many shots at such a low clip, and Ellis will need to adjust his game if he hopes to be a contributor on a championship-caliber team.
For the Bucks, they still seem to have interest in Ellis, as they were unwilling to part with him during last seasons trade deadline and they reportedly offered him the extension mentioned earlier.
Unfortunately for Milwaukee, it appears they will have to overpay for the guard if they want to retain him. The other half of the Bucks starting backcourt, Brandon Jennings, may also be looking to leave Milwaukee, but as a restricted free-agent, the Bucks can match any offer sheet he signs.
No matter what the backcourt looks like on opening night, the vibe from the organization and new head coach Larry Drew is they plan to build around young big men Larry Sanders and John Henson from this point forward.
